Can you share any historical facts about the suburb of Plympton?
Plympton was named after Henry Mooringe Boswarva’s hometown in Devon and officially adopted that name in 1944. The suburb retains remnants of the former Holdfast Bay railway line, now part of a West Side cycleway, and once hosted a plumpton track and the Adelaide Hunt Club’s kennels.
